description Product Description
Used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of angiotensin II receptor antagonists, particularly in the production of antihypertensive drugs like candesartan and similar sartan-class medications. Its tetrazole ring mimics the carboxylic acid group in biological systems, enhancing binding affinity to the AT1 receptor. Widely utilized in pharmaceutical development for its metabolic stability and bioavailability when incorporated into active drug molecules. Also employed in research for designing new bioactive compounds due to its favorable pharmacokinetic properties.
